What Exactly Are Fix and Flip Loans?

Fix and flip loans, also known as hard money loans, are short-term financing options that enable investors to acquire and renovate investment properties. Unlike traditional mortgages that can take 30-45 days to close, a first time fix and flip loan Sun Prairie can often close within 7-14 days, giving you the competitive edge needed in today's fast-paced real estate market.

These loans are asset-based, meaning lenders focus primarily on the property's value and potential rather than your credit score or income history. This makes hard money for new investors Sun Prairie WI an accessible option even if you're just starting your real estate investment journey.

How Fix and Flip Loans Work: The Process Simplified

When you're flipping houses for beginners Sun Prairie, the loan process typically follows these key steps:

1. Property Identification and Analysis: You identify a potential flip property and analyze its After Repair Value (ARV). Lenders typically finance 70-80% of the ARV, which includes both the purchase price and renovation costs.

2. Quick Application and Approval: Submit your application with property details, renovation plans, and budget estimates. Most hard money lenders can provide approval within 24-48 hours.

3. Fast Closing: Once approved, you can close on the property within days, not weeks. This speed is crucial when competing against cash buyers in Sun Prairie's competitive market.

4. Renovation Phase: Use the loan funds to complete your planned renovations. Many lenders provide funds in draws as work progresses, ensuring you have capital when you need it.

5. Exit Strategy: Sell the renovated property and pay off the loan, keeping the profit for yourself.

Important Considerations for Beginners

While hard money for new investors Sun Prairie WI offers excellent opportunities, it's essential to understand the considerations:

Higher Interest Rates: Fix and flip loans typically carry higher interest rates than traditional mortgages, usually ranging from 8-15%. However, since these are short-term loans (typically 6-18 months), the total interest paid is often manageable.

Points and Fees: Expect to pay 2-5 points (percentage of loan amount) in origination fees. Factor these costs into your project budget from the beginning.

Timeline Pressure: These loans are designed for quick turnarounds. Having a solid renovation plan and reliable contractors is crucial for success.

Underestimating Renovation Costs and Timelines

One of the most frequent mistakes when flipping houses for beginners Sun Prairie is severely underestimating both the cost and time required for renovations. New flippers often budget based on surface-level improvements without accounting for hidden issues like outdated electrical systems, plumbing problems, or structural concerns common in Sun Prairie's older housing stock.

To avoid this costly error, always add a 20-30% contingency buffer to your renovation budget. Work with experienced local contractors who understand Sun Prairie's building codes and permit requirements. Before finalizing your hard money for new investors Sun Prairie WI loan, conduct thorough property inspections and obtain detailed contractor estimates for all anticipated work.

Overleveraging and Poor Financial Planning

Many beginner real estate investor Sun Prairie enthusiasts make the mistake of using every available dollar for their first flip, leaving no cushion for unexpected expenses or market changes. This overleveraging can quickly turn a profitable project into a financial disaster if renovation costs exceed estimates or the property takes longer to sell than anticipated.

When applying for your first time fix and flip loan Sun Prairie, ensure you maintain adequate cash reserves beyond the loan amount. A good rule of thumb is keeping 6-12 months of holding costs in reserve, including property taxes, insurance, utilities, and loan payments.
